Step 3: Analyze Cost and Investment Decisions

Choice
Hotels is interested in bolstering their assets and improving their
costing model to account for these assets. Choice Hotels has been
building their own guest rooms and selling them to their franchise
owners. The company allocates overhead costs equally to each guest room
and prices them to achieve a greater profit on the higher-priced rooms.
Choice Hotels is concerned that this traditional costing model may not
be accurately assigning costs. For example, the selling price of one of
its guest rooms, “Presidential Suite,” may not be covering its true
cost. You and your team will need to apply activity-based costing (ABC) to advise Choice Hotels on resolving the company’s costing issue with the Presidential Suite guest room.

Also, your team will need to understand the concepts of production cost allocation, and breakeven
to compare costing models. Two cost allocation methods of production
are under consideration by Choice Hotels. Frank needs your team’s help
in determining if overhead cost allocation (Choice’s traditional model)
or ABC (a new model) is better for their business.
